We are looking to appoint a Chartered Structural Engineer to lead and develop our structural engineering capability as part of our wider design and delivery team. This role offers an excellent opportunity to take ownership of engineering solutions and contribute to the strategic growth of the business.
The role includes responsibility for the design of bespoke screw piling, ground beams, and hybrid structures.
